At the CMC, mediation is a constructive process that enables people to find a solution acceptable to all involved parties. CMC mediations are appropriate for:

  • divorcing or separating families
  • parent/child relations
  • landlord/tenant issues
  • employer/employee disputes
  • business/business relations
  • school conflicts
  • church (congregation) conflicts
  • organizational issues
  • community problems
  • governmental relationships

CMC Mediation:

  • is inexpensive and effective
  • may provide a quicker, enduring resolution versus court action
  • is confidential
  • is constructive and may help preserve relationships
  • allows each client to express his or her thoughts, feelings, and needs
  • is a way for individuals to reach a decisions themselves rather than receive a solution from a judge or similar authority figure
  • saves valuable time and money
  • reduces the chances of children being hurt (if they are a factor)
  • gets results—roughly 90% of those who try mediation are satisfied clients
